Harold Michael Croner (born January 25, 1985) is an American actor and voice actor, best known for voicing J.P. Mercer in the Cartoon Network series Craig of the Creek. He has also worked on shows, such as Hot in Cleveland, Workaholics, Mom, We Bare Bears, The Big Bang Theory, Mike Tyson Mysteries, Unikitty!, Young Sheldon, and F is for Family. For Disney, he played Hootie Kephart in Zeke and Luther. He also voiced Chad Starlight and Obvious Teen in Wander Over Yonder, Lazer, Mam Mams, and The Rat King in Pickle and Peanut, and Barry Buns in Kiff. Additionally, he played Robert in the ABC series Don't Trust the B---- in Apartment 23.
